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28207629 567762549 07948306 82326046782 3370
81460 75836282
81460 75836282
939096763 604 9492107 1264474
All about undefined
Interested in learning more?
81460 75836282
939096763 604 9492107 1264474
See more
96401157335 5538436 66415282000
02 055428 13 912 1862
See more
14621996 47020
0285589376 834 3522571993
See more